735872420567 has 2 divisors, whose sum is σ = 735872420568. Its totient is φ = 735872420566.

The previous prime is 735872420531. The next prime is 735872420597. The reversal of 735872420567 is 765024278537.

It is a strong prime.

It is an emirp because it is prime and its reverse (765024278537) is a distict prime.

It is a cyclic number.

It is not a de Polignac number, because 735872420567 - 210 = 735872419543 is a prime.

It is a super-2 number, since 2×7358724205672 (a number of 25 digits) contains 22 as substring.

It is a congruent number.

It is not a weakly prime, because it can be changed into another prime (735872420597) by changing a digit.

It is a polite number, since it can be written as a sum of consecutive naturals, namely, 367936210283 + 367936210284.

It is an arithmetic number, because the mean of its divisors is an integer number (367936210284).

Almost surely, 2735872420567 is an apocalyptic number.

735872420567 is a deficient number, since it is larger than the sum of its proper divisors (1).

735872420567 is an equidigital number, since it uses as much as digits as its factorization.

735872420567 is an odious number, because the sum of its binary digits is odd.

The product of its (nonzero) digits is 19756800, while the sum is 56.
